RunArray.st
changeset 3208 61e00bd988d2
parent 3117 21453eeba760
child 3323 f1239164bea5
--- a/RunArray.st	Thu Mar 06 21:53:21 2014 +0100
+++ b/RunArray.st	Fri Mar 07 23:06:25 2014 +0100
@@ -697,7 +697,7 @@
     idx2 := 1.
     runCount2 := 0.
 
-    [true] whileTrue:[
+    [
         runCount1 == 0 ifTrue:[
             idx1 >= contentsArray size ifTrue:[
                 idx2+1 <= otherContents size ifTrue:[^ false].
@@ -725,7 +725,7 @@
             runCount2 := runCount2 - runCount1.
             runCount1 := 0.
         ].
-    ].
+    ] loop.
 
     "
      'hello' asText sameStringAndEmphasisAs: 'hello' asText
@@ -1386,10 +1386,10 @@
 !RunArray class methodsFor:'documentation'!
 
 version
-    ^ '$Header: /cvs/stx/stx/libbasic2/RunArray.st,v 1.35 2013-09-05 23:12:44 cg Exp $'
+    ^ '$Header: /cvs/stx/stx/libbasic2/RunArray.st,v 1.36 2014-03-07 22:06:25 stefan Exp $'
 !
 
 version_CVS
-    ^ '$Header: /cvs/stx/stx/libbasic2/RunArray.st,v 1.35 2013-09-05 23:12:44 cg Exp $'
+    ^ '$Header: /cvs/stx/stx/libbasic2/RunArray.st,v 1.36 2014-03-07 22:06:25 stefan Exp $'
 ! !